One of my favourite beaches of the holiday. A lovely bay with nice soft sand with a gentle slope into the warm sea, which is calm by comparison to Chaweng. There are plenty of restaurants and massage huts, you can lie out on the beach as there is a decent amount of shade or hire loungers, about 200 baht each with a parasol. Also bean bags and towels available.
Sat outside Pure for the day and chilled with tasty snacks and cold drinks. All very clean, good wi fi and a hospitable owner!

The calm waters at Chong Mon beach is different to Chewang beach you can walk out for ages and paddle great for kids no under current like Chewang which can be dangerous so watch out.
Chong Mon beach has lots of 5 star hotels for lunch and pool days pay 1500 baht and spend the day in each one you can spend the 1500 on your lunch drinks it’s great value and a perfect way to enjoy the luxury side of the island without staying in the five star hotels.
Also lots of sun beds along the beach which again if you buy drinks at the place they are sitting you can stay all day for free. Sunset is pretty here.

Loved this attractive beach. Beautiful sand and gently shelving into the sea. About 15 minutes to walk from one end to the other. Lovely vibe and a good selection of restaurants and bars.

Hi,
The islands near Koh Samui are small and many have no accommodation but don't yak long by speed boat or ferry to get to them. Most people go to them because that want to do scuba, snorkelling, swimming or hiking in beautiful unspoiled surroundings. You can easily organise trips to them from any hotel or booking agent in Koh Samui. The distance between the two beaches is about 10 mins by taxi and is very cheap maybe 100 to 140 Thai baht. Easy to hire motorbike/ moped or a car to get around if you are going to be there for a couple of weeks. You can try these near by islands: Koh Phangan, Koh Tao about the only islands with tourist accommodation and facilities, just TripAdvisor them to get more info.
